WebTo be classified as a bourbon, a whiskey must meet several key criteria. First, it must be made in the United States. Second, it must be made from a mash that has at least 51% corn. Third, it must be distilled to no more than 160 proof and aged in a … WebJul 6, 2024 · Rules In Aging Bourbons A bottle labeled “straight bourbon” means that the spirit has aged for a minimum of two years inside new, charred oak barrels.
